Peleus and Thetis’ wedding - big party Everyone was invited, except…

Eris (goddess of discord and confusion)

Snub? Discord?

Page 4: Youre already doing your do now, and you didnt even know it.

Golden Apple (a.k.a. Apple of Discord) “To the Fairest” Choice narrowed to three goddesses

who believe it should be theirs: Hera Athena Aphrodite

Naturally, the three women cannot agree and remain fascinated by the apple and their own vanity

Zeus is charged with making the decision

It’s a no-win decision – each will get revenge if not chosen

Paris, a mere mortal but a looker himself, is chosen by Zeus to decide

At Paris’ birth, the prophecy was made that he would cause Troy’s downfall, but this has nothing to do with Troy… does it?

Page 8: Youre already doing your do now, and you didnt even know it.

Hera offers power; she helps Paris think of thrones, conquest, and all of Asia at his feet

Athena offers wisdom; Paris would use such wisdom in battle and be an impressive strategist

Aprhodite offers lust; Paris could have the most beautiful woman in the world

Paris made his choice with, well… not his brain

Paris chooses Aphrodite; he is to be awarded Helen

Page 11: Youre already doing your do now, and you didnt even know it.

Paris was already married to a nymph Oenone

Helen was already married to Menelaus, king of Sparta

Paris ignored his wife’s warnings and set out for Helen anyway, taking her back to Troy Aphrodite called upon her “partner in crime,”

Eros (Cupid), in order to make Helen fall in love with Paris

Whether Helen went willingly or not, the Greeks want their queen back

Agememnon, brother of Menelaus, leads an expedition to Troy

He enlists all the former suitors of Helen who had promised to protect her regardless of not becoming her husband

1,000 ships set sail to Troy for Helen’s return

Ten years of war Ends with Trojan Horse leading to the

sack of Troy, an idea attributed to Odysseus

Much destruction angers the gods, who prevent many from returning home

The Odyssey tells the story of Odysseus’ challenging journey to get home
